    Important detail to note for Brazilian Revolt. Voluntario de Patria are weak because they have an inherent -50% penalty to HP and Damage. This means that while their initial HP is 100, their base HP is actually 200, which in turns means that all HP and Attack cards provide twice the value that one would expect. It's not a bug, it's a feature. This means that advanced arsenal upgrades are a must-have.

    The Canadian revolution seems to be clearly designed as a Counter-Revolution Revolution, so it could become popular if aggressive revolutions are viable. Fully upgraded CDBs (Great coat, Pioneers, Wilderness Warfare, Northwest Passage, Blunderbuss) become the perfect counter to a horde of revolutionaries - 574 hp with 40% rr (800 effective ranged hp), 5.4 speed, 24 attack with 16 range and a double modifier against artillery. Additionally you get grizzlies instead of cav, so revolutionaries don't get their bonus there. So I don't think it's a fair characterisation to say this revolution causes you to sack your economy for no benefit - since A) your upgraded settlers still gather, and B) they're very effective against revolutionaries and heavy artillery.

    With the Dutch Brazilian revolt, you max your vills/banks, rush age 4, keep shipments to a minimal to save them up for when you revolt. Keep a saloon and a foundry, facs as well.
    You can revolt before 16 minutes and have saved 2-6 ships depending on the fighting intensity.
    What makes the Dutch Brazil revolt so strong is the auto spawning 9 stack of patrias can be supported by cannons and mercenaries from the saloon. Either heavy cannons or horse guns/falcs.
    Once you hit 15+ TCs which is easy to reach if you saved shipments, you get a constant flow of men who can provide nonstop pressure to an enemy’s front.
    The real fighting power comes from the cannons (possibly mercs too) which the Dutch can uniquely spam due to having banks producing gold and a fac on gold/wood.
    This only snowballs and can reach ridiculous levels of constantly being at 200+/200 men. Your opponent is forced to put everything into defense and you essentially lock their economy down producing troops while you gain xp from fighting which means more tcs which means a slow but unstoppable flow of more and more men.
    Supporting those brave but numerous and poorly equipped men with cannons or heavy hitting mercs such as Jaegers (if you’re lucky enough to get a map with jaegers) you’re unstoppable.
    It is possible to defeat an age 5 civ with this strategy.
    I have defeated age 5 jap ashi/yumi/arrow spam with this setup. And age 5 otto abus/Jan/huss.
    If you catch your opponent in age4 and keep them in age 4, you cannot be defeated.
